Output e38b23dcd88aa7a84a523a95be2ebeb9ed019d70a93d0e1f88a848c4b6deb923:1

value
91605
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0535521879425aa6d87cffcd6925bd6e95132a8e OP_EQUAL
address
32AZBHiqJbBA3rdh6m3yXFVFaD1o1zFd2S
transaction
e38b23dcd88aa7a84a523a95be2ebeb9ed019d70a93d0e1f88a848c4b6deb923